Output c625862324995361b9e37a5e16fd8e37800b7c763cf8a066ec7e4ab5c672ec48:3

value
40903291
script pubkey
OP_0 OP_PUSHBYTES_20 12e52b0821e1fea44de842594b0d2fd941263189
address
bc1qztjjkzppu8l2gn0ggfv5krf0m9qjvvvf04fck6
transaction
c625862324995361b9e37a5e16fd8e37800b7c763cf8a066ec7e4ab5c672ec48